She spends most of her time on the tummy, the newer development being, she puts both her hands forward together and rests her chin on them and looks around the room .I adore this pose of hers.And something even more interesting is, the way she looks around for a while and then suddenly, she covers her face in her hands and moves her legs up and down,while lying on her tummy(like we do when we are in deep deep thought), as if saying,"oh god!i've got so many things to do ..what do i do next?"
While on her back, she holds both her hands in a fist,close to her mouth and in an animated conversation with us,blows bubbles and says,"ageeee ageee buuuuu khreeeee aaay aay".How I wish we could speak like her too, to be understood by her.We do try our best, though.And when I talk to her (mostly in her language),and make faces,her face lightens with joy, her mouth widens in a big grin, and she puts a lil of her tongue out and nods her head sideways and waves her arms and legs! and that makes me proud of my achievement....to have got her nod of approval and acceptance.
She's been showing symptoms of teething for more than two weeks now.I spent days trying to find a Stage 1 teething ring for her but most stores here, including Mothercare,carry only Stage 2 onwards.I've been looking out for the jelly filled rings which would be soft on her tender gums but what i find are thr slightly harder, water filled rings.Will have to wait a few more days before I can get them.
